- Description
- This modification transmits clarifications to the original Combined Synopsis/Solicitation 1.Closing Date. The closing date shall be extended until August 27, 2008 at 2:00 pm local time. 2.Time Frame for Project Completion. The NPS desires the project to be completed in 2008 or as soon as possible pending battery availability. 3.Battery Delivery Time. Please list in your proposal the time (days) required for delivery of the batteries to the receiving site after the Notice to Proceed has been given. 4.Removing and Installing the Batteries. The National Park Service shall remove the old batteries from the facilities and place the new batteries into position. The NPS shall transport the batteries to and from Dangling Rope to the NPS receiving site at Wahweap. The Contractor shall provide on-site technical support during the removal of the old batteries and the installation of the new batteries to ensure proper placement of the batteries for warranty purposes. It is the responsibility of the contractor to disconnect the old batteries and reconnect the new batteries to provide continuity of the battery cables. 5.Use of Existing Battery Cables. The contractor shall be allowed to use the existing battery cables. It is also the responsibility of the contractor to inspect, test, and verify battery cable usability. 6.Installing Battery Temperature Probe. It is the Contractors responsibility to install, calibrate, and test the existing battery temperature probe and associated equipment to the new batteries. 7.Battery Testing. a.The Contractor shall perform initial testing (i.e., system voltage, cell voltage, specific gravity, and temperature) for the purpose of determining a baseline for the batteries as well as determining bad cells after the initial installation for warranty purposes. b.Load Bank Testing: The contractor shall test the batteries using a load bank, in accordance with contract specifications and the manufacturer's recommendations, after the installation of the batteries to ensure a proper and efficient operation as a part of the off-grid hybrid electrical power system at Dangling Rope. The Contractor shall verify in writing the testing results and that the batteries will perform in accordance with contract specifications. c.It is the intent of the NPS to charge and equalize the batteries immediately after installation and upon verification of the on-site Contractors Technical Representative of the battery system put the system on-line as soon as possible. If load bank testing is to be performed 30 - 60 days after initial installation then the Contractor shall take responsibility of the batteries and battery conditions during that time frame. 8.Spill Containment Systems. The contract specifications read that the batteries shall in some manner possess a secondary containment. This can be contained in the batteries, as we have now, or a spill containment barrier around all the strings. The contractor purposes what system they purpose to provide. The NPS shall select the system that best meets their needs.
